Diffuse damage
Damage to the head can lead to severe and sometimes permanent disabilities. It happens when the brain moves inside the skull. It can manifest as symptoms immediately or months later. The treatment is designed to reduce swelling, prevent injuries that can cause secondary injury and speed up rehabilitation.
Axonal injuries that are diffuse are diagnosed through radiographic and clinical findings. Additional tests are required in some instances to confirm the diagnosis.
Axonal injuries that are diffuse can be treated, prevented, by rehabilitation and stabilization. Speech therapy, occupational therapy and psychotherapy are all options. People who have suffered from severe DAI usually require ongoing rehabilitation therapies.
A patient with DAI usually remains in a persistent vegetative state for several weeks, but some patients are conscious. There may be symptoms of brain damage. This condition is often caused by the shearing of nerve fibers within the brain.
To treat diffuse axonal traumas, the first step is to minimize swelling in the brain. Brain swelling can lead to further injury, such as a decrease in blood flow to the brain. Therefore, prompt medical treatment is vital to prevent the onset of edema as well as elevated intracranial pressure.
In severe cases of DAI surgery may be an option. Steroids are often used to reduce inflammation. You may also need to consider changing your diet or taking anti-inflammatory drugs.
The victims of axonal injuries that are diffuse can experience physical or mental problems, including headaches, memory loss, and difficulties in communicating. These problems can impact their job or personal life.
